1 Objectives to be followed with the implementation of the Direct Tax Code from the next financial year.

Mr. Bharat Shah informed that with the implementation of the Direct Tax Code, there are likely to be some major changes in the accounting system and income & expenditure pattern of all Trusts and ISOLA will come under its ambit.

Major implications: (a) All spendings must be within listed objectives. (b) "Charitable purposes" replaced with "permitted welfare activities":
  • Clause b – Advancement of education and enhancement of knowledge
  • Clause d – Preservation of environment
